joining me now is cnn's tom foreman at the magic wall to explain it all.ut this storm surge. take a step back with me. how does this work? >> storm surges -- always what it is primarily about in hurricanes. people look at the wind, the wind is dramatic, you can get a hurricane that can do damage, but a storm surges where they are saying if you are in a directly hit area could be not survivable in this case. a storm like nothing they have seen since the 1800s, with blocked roams, home destructions, massive power outages. so, how to storm surges work? think about that big swirling storm we talk about all the time. every place that it is contacting the water, it is pushing water in front of it. so, if you are out in deep water, out here it pushes the water in epic circular motion. well, so what? because it's deep enough and just keeps growing down into the water, it does not matter. but when it gets into a more shallow area it runs out of space, and the water that is being pushed on the parts going towards gland could go down anymore, and it starts going and

tom foreman is here to explain it all. so tom, with trump appearing as you know, obviously, the clock is starting to tick. a lot is happening immediately. tell us what's going on. >> when he stood up in court, that started the clock and the calendar moving. why? constitutionally, we are guaranteed a speedy trial, but in 1974, the speedy trial act came along and put finer teeth on that and said the act establishes time limits for completing the various stages of a federal criminal prosecution. trial must commence within 70 days from the date the indictment was filed or from the date the defendant appears before an officer of the court. in which the charge is pending. that happened today. which ever is later. the reason this was put into place is because you want trial to move along quickly to keep the accused from waiting in jail. donald trump is not in jail, but many people are so you want to say you can't serve a sentence waiting to be tried. that is not right. to maintain witnesses, the memory of witnesses. the availabili

as tom foreman reports. >> reporter: oh, the irony here.he company that taught us all how we could work from home and see each other, zoom, is now saying that it wants its workers in the office at least two days out of every week. and they are not alone this doing that. several others have done the same thing. google, salesforce and amazon and the u.s. government are saying we like the idea of people being there face-to-face, we like the synergy, the productivity that comes out of it. but a lot of workers are not so convinced, especially you thinker w thinker -- younger workers say they don't like executing because of the gas and time. and they don't like paying extra child care. 14% think that. 13% say that they are better able to focus. what is the difference here in what they want? generally employers want 1.6 days at home per week. that is weird. we don't take 0.6 days. so they say two days at home is enough and workers say three days at home. workers have a strong hand to play here because so many employers are still trying to find eno
